#f48031 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f48031 is composed of 95.7% red, 50.2% green and 19.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 47.5% magenta, 79.9%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 24.3 degrees, a saturation of 89.9% and a lightness of 57.5%. #f48031 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ff62 with #e90100. Closest websafe color is: #ff9933.

#f48031 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f48031 has RGB values of R:244, G:128, B:49 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.48, Y:0.8,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16023601.

Shades and Tints of #f48031
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110801 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.
